After leaving the Jedi Order, Ahsoka Tano is confused, alone, and distressed. She has just left behind the only life she's ever known, and for the first time in her life, she does not know what to do. In hopes of being able to sort everything else, she seeks out an old friend. Will leaving the Order turn out to be a big mistake, or will it change her life for the better?
